Al Roker Was Taken Back to the Hospital Immediately After Being Discharged the Day Before

The famous NBC weather reporter was rushed back to the hospital via ambulance

Al Roker, the famous NBC weather reporter, was immediately brought back to the hospital after a day of being discharged. Al Roker had previously been hospitalized for blood clots in his leg and lungs.

“Al was rushed to the hospital after Thanksgiving,” according to PEOPLE.

He was taken to the hospital in an ambulance, and Page Six reported that “his condition was worrying, but once back in the hospital he improved.” 

“Al had to go to the hospital in an ambulance, and [Roker’s wife Deborah Roberts] was locked out of her car and couldn’t get inside it. The car malfunctioned. She couldn’t get her phone or any of her belongings,” an inside source reported to PEOPLE.

Al Roker stated two weeks ago on his Instagram page about being hospitalized. He also thanked everyone for their support and he was improving.

“So many of you have been thoughtfully asking where I’ve been. Last week I was admitted to the hospital with a blood clot in my leg which sent some clots into my lungs. After some medical whack-a-mole, I am so fortunate to be getting terrific medical care and on the way to recovery. Thanks for all the well wishes and prayers and hope to see you soon. Have a great weekend, everyone,” captioned Al Roker on social media.
